Output 25a30fd6235f073542e8f39e9043882a0921ab57e3f2b04d49fe24d0de826564:0

value
511492954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24185cf391aa56ebdfc5546a93013268cecf91b9 OP_EQUALVERIFY OP_CHECKSIG
address
14HrWgdCNigyK1tdsrC6YG9ByCvPvqzLAa
transaction
25a30fd6235f073542e8f39e9043882a0921ab57e3f2b04d49fe24d0de826564
spent
true